The UAE transportation industry is primarily driven by increasing urbanization, significant government investment in infrastructure, rising e-commerce demand, and technological advancements in transportation solutions. These factors collectively enhance service efficiency and accessibility across the region.
Key challenges include traffic congestion, regulatory compliance issues, high operational costs, and environmental concerns. These factors can hinder the efficiency and sustainability of transportation services, necessitating strategic solutions from industry stakeholders.
Opportunities in the UAE transportation market include the expansion of public transport systems, adoption of electric vehicles, development of smart transportation solutions, and increased investment in logistics and supply chain management, which can enhance service delivery and operational efficiency.
The UAE transportation industry is evolving through the integration of smart technologies, a shift towards sustainable practices, and the expansion of ride-sharing services. These trends are reshaping user experiences and operational frameworks within the sector.
Government regulations significantly impact the UAE transportation industry by establishing emission standards, licensing requirements, and safety regulations for public transport. These regulations aim to enhance service quality, safety, and environmental sustainability across the sector.
